html怎么在服务器上运行php文件

不及物动词 其他 67

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在服务器上运行PHP文件,你需要按照以下步骤进行操作:

    1. 首先,确保你的服务器已经安装了PHP解析器。PHP解析器是将PHP文件转换成可被服务器执行的代码的程序。你可以通过在终端中输入命令`php -v`来检查是否已经安装了PHP,如果已经安装了,你将会看到PHP版本信息。

    2. 将你的PHP文件放置在服务器上的适当位置。通常情况下,服务器的根目录是”www”或者”htdocs”,你可以将你的PHP文件放置在这个文件夹中,以便能够通过浏览器访问到它。

    3. 确认你的PHP文件具有正确的文件扩展名。PHP文件的扩展名通常是”.php”,请确保你的文件扩展名是正确的,否则服务器将无法识别它为PHP文件。

    4. 配置你的服务器以解析PHP文件。不同的服务器软件有不同的配置方法,下面是几个常见的服务器软件的配置方法:

    – Apache服务器:如果你使用的是Apache服务器,你需要在服务器配置文件中添加下面的指令来启用PHP解析器:

    “`
    LoadModule php_module modules/libphp.so
    AddHandler php-script .php
    “`

    – Nginx服务器:如果你使用的是Nginx服务器,你需要在服务器配置文件中添加下面的指令来启用PHP解析器:

    “`
    location ~ \.php$ {
    fastcgi_pass 127.0.0.1:9000;
    fastcgi_index index.php;
    include fastcgi_params;
    f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
    fastcgi_param PATH_INFO $fastcgi_path_info;
    }
    “`

    – IIS服务器:如果你使用的是IIS服务器,你需要在IIS管理器中配置PHP解析器。具体的操作方法可以参考PHP的官方文档或者搜索引擎中相关的教程。

    5. 重启你的服务器。在完成以上配置之后,你需要重新启动服务器以使配置生效。不同的服务器软件有不同的重启方法,请根据你使用的服务器软件进行相应的操作。

    6. 在浏览器中访问你的PHP文件。在完成以上步骤之后,你可以通过在浏览器中输入你的PHP文件的URL来访问它。例如,如果你的PHP文件名为”hello.php”,那么你可以在浏览器中输入”http://你的服务器IP地址/hello.php”来访问它。

    现在,你已经知道了如何在服务器上运行PHP文件。记得在开发阶段和生产环境中都要对PHP文件进行适当的安全性处理,以防止潜在的安全威胁。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要在服务器上运行PHP文件,需要进行以下步骤:

    1. 安装服务器软件:首先,你需要在服务器上安装一个支持PHP的服务器软件,比如Apache、Nginx或者IIS。这些服务器软件都有各自的安装步骤,你可以根据服务器的操作系统选择合适的服务器软件进行安装。

    2. 配置服务器:安装完成服务器软件后,需要进行一些配置以使其能够正确解析PHP文件。具体的配置步骤可能因服务器软件而异。对于Apache服务器,你需要修改`httpd.conf`文件或者`php.ini`文件,添加适当的配置项来启用PHP解析。对于Nginx服务器,你需要配置`nginx.conf`文件,添加相应的指令来启用PHP解析。

    3. 将PHP文件上传到服务器:将你的PHP文件上传到服务器的指定位置,一般是服务器的web根目录。在Apache服务器中,web根目录的默认路径是`/var/www/html`,在Nginx服务器中,默认路径是`/usr/share/nginx/html`。你可以将PHP文件直接上传到这些目录中,或者按照自己的需求创建一个新的目录用于存放PHP文件。

    4. 在浏览器中访问PHP文件:完成以上步骤后,你可以在浏览器中使用服务器的IP地址或者域名访问PHP文件。只需在浏览器地址栏中输入服务器的IP地址或域名,后面加上你上传的PHP文件的路径。比如,如果你的服务器IP地址是192.168.0.100,PHP文件是`test.php`,那么在浏览器中输入`http://192.168.0.100/test.php`即可查看PHP文件的运行结果。

    5. 调试和错误处理:如果在运行PHP文件时出现错误,你可以通过查看服务器的错误日志来定位问题。错误日志文件的位置也因服务器软件而异。在Apache服务器中,错误日志一般位于`/var/log/apache2/error.log`;在Nginx服务器中,错误日志一般位于`/var/log/nginx/error.log`。通过查看错误日志,你可以找到具体的错误信息,并进行调试和错误处理。

    以上就是在服务器上运行PHP文件的基本步骤。根据不同的服务器软件和配置方式,具体的步骤可能会有所不同,你可以根据服务器软件的官方文档或者相关教程来获取更详细的指导。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要在服务器上运行PHP文件,需要按照以下步骤来配置服务器。

    1. 安装服务器软件
    首先,需要在服务器上安装可执行PHP代码的服务器软件,如Apache、Nginx或IIS。在安装过程中,确保选择安装PHP模块或插件。

    2. 配置服务器
    安装完服务器软件后,需要对其进行一些配置,以让服务器能够正确地解析PHP文件。
    – 对于Apache服务器,可以通过编辑Apache的配置文件 httpd.conf(或 apache2.conf)进行配置。找到 `LoadModule` 的一行,确认 `mod_php` 这个模块被加载,并确保 `AddType` 指令包含 `application/x-httpd-php .php .html`。
    – 对于Nginx服务器,需要编辑Nginx的配置文件 nginx.conf。找到 `location` 的一段,添加以下内容:
    “`
    location ~ \.php$ {
    root html;
    fastcgi_pass 127.0.0.1:9000;
    fastcgi_index index.php;
    f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
    include fastcgi_params;
    }
    “`
    – 对于IIS服务器,需要启用PHP支持。可以通过服务器管理器打开IIS管理器,选择Web服务器角色,然后选择“添加角色服务”,选择“PHP”并继续安装。

    3. 配置PHP
    安装PHP后,需要对其进行一些配置,以确保它能够与服务器软件正常配合工作。
    – 对于Apache服务器,可以通过编辑php.ini文件进行配置。找到 `extension_dir` 一行,确保指向正确的PHP扩展目录,并找到 `;extension=php_xxx.dll` 注释行,删除注释符号 `;` 并保存。
    – 对于Nginx服务器,可以在PHP安装目录中找到php.ini文件,并按需进行配置。
    – 对于IIS服务器,可以通过IIS管理器中的PHP管理器来配置PHP。

    4. 测试文件运行
    配置完服务器和PHP以后,可以创建一个简单的PHP文件来测试是否正常运行。在服务器的Web根目录(如htdocs或www目录)中创建一个名为 `test.php` 的文本文件,内容如下:
    “`

    “`
    保存文件后,使用浏览器打开访问 `http://服务器IP/test.php`,如果看到PHP信息页面,说明服务器已成功配置。

    以上是在服务器上运行PHP文件的基本步骤。根据不同的服务器软件和操作系统,具体的配置方法可能有所不同,可以根据具体情况进行调整。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部